    yes the Suez problem will cause some price rises and delays, but it shouldn't be enough to push up our inflation.

    I saw the other day an explanation from a logistics company rep.
    Going around South Africa would add a couple of weeks to a trip.
    ..but in the short term a lot of pick up and drop off bookings would have to be rearranged for containers because by changing the route ships will now be arriving at what were destination ports before what were pickup ports.
    Prices for shipping forecast to go up but nowhere near as much as they did during the pandemic.

    USA advise that their maritime force would operate as a patrol rather than escorting ships.

    Some say that the force would be ineffective unless they strike land based facilities.
    Presumably the USA mulling that option.


    Also Egypt will be annoyed at losing the transit fees of ships that usually transit the Suez canal.
